We are looking for a Claims Handler to join our fast-paced team in Manchester. If you are an experienced commercial lines Claims Handler who thrives on a challenge and are a real customer champion, you could be just the person to join our team. Experience in Professional Indemnity claims would be an advantage.

Claims is at the forefront of our service. Our clients rely upon us to deliver when they most need us, resolve issues, keep them in the loop and generally fight their corner. The role exists to manage claims for our professional indemnity clients (construction, Solicitors, Accountants), keeping them updated and quickly resolving issues as they arise. As well as maintaining a claim caseload, you will prepare claims analysis reports and assist with the training and developing of more junior colleagues.

Claims is a fast-paced environment where you are constantly learning new things and brokering solutions our clients are happy with; no two days are the same.
